Recipe: Strawberries and cream cheese crepes

Dietitian's tip: Using fat-free cream cheese in these crepes instead of full-fat cream cheese saves 67 calories and 10 grams of fat a serving.

By Mayo Clinic staff
Serves 4

Ingredients

    • 4 ounces fat-free cream cheese, softened
    • 2 tablespoons sifted powdered sugar
    •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
    • 2 prepackaged crepes, each about 8 inches in diameter8 strawberries, hulled and sliced
    • 1 teaspoon powdered sugar for garnish
    • 2 tablespoons caramel sauce, warmed

Directions

Preheat the oven to 325 F. Lightly coat a baking dish with cooking spray.

In a mixing bowl, blend the cream cheese until smooth using an electric mixer. Add the powdered sugar and vanilla. Mix well.

Spread 1/2 of the cream cheese mixture on each crepe, leaving 1/2 inch around the edge. Top with 2 tablespoons strawberries. Roll up and place seam-side down in the prepared baking dish. Bake until lightly browned, about 10 minutes.

Cut crepes in half. Transfer to four individual serving plates. Sprinkle each with powdered sugar and top with 1/2 tablespoon caramel sauce. Serve immediately.

Nutritional analysis per serving

Serving size: 1/2 crepe
Calories156 Sodium327 mg
Total fat4 g Total carbohydrate22 g
Saturated fat1 g Dietary fiber1 g
Monounsaturated fat2 g Protein8 g
Cholesterol54 mg
